Output d8c3012a32dd2ee84fc30faa824e1104580cdf5bd52aa6f336ea66fa2dd1a029:1

value
33580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0637d0664146c9ac1a74424e3bc67c008eb40e59 OP_EQUAL
address
32FtqivYr4yLdcGGeVTJC2ZoM2s87hFyWw
transaction
d8c3012a32dd2ee84fc30faa824e1104580cdf5bd52aa6f336ea66fa2dd1a029
spent
true